How it works
This blend works through simultaneous activation of two independent pathways on pituitary somatotroph cells:
CJC-1295 no DAC (Mod GRF 1-29)
Binds GHRH receptors on pituitary somatotrophs, activating the cAMP/PKA signaling cascade to prime and release stored GH granules. The four amino acid substitutions (Ala2, Glu8, Ala15, Leu27) protect against DPP-IV degradation, extending the half-life to approximately 30 minutes versus 7-10 minutes for native GHRH. Without the DAC (Drug Affinity Complex) linker, it produces acute GH pulses rather than sustained elevation, preserving natural pulsatile GH patterns.
Ipamorelin
Binds GHS-R1a (ghrelin receptor) on pituitary somatotrophs, triggering GH release through the PLC/IP3/PKC pathway - entirely separate from the GHRH pathway. Also suppresses somatostatin release, removing the natural brake on GH secretion. Unlike GHRP-6 and GHRP-2, Ipamorelin does not significantly activate cortisol, prolactin, or appetite pathways, providing the cleanest GH signal of any GHRP.
Synergistic Amplification
The simultaneous GHRH signal (CJC) and GHRP signal (Ipamorelin) converge on somatotrophs through independent intracellular pathways, producing GH pulses 3-5x greater than either peptide alone. This mimics the body's natural dual-signal GH regulation system, where GHRH and ghrelin coordinate pulsatile release.

Evidence
Claims we could not support
No abstract we checked supports these for this molecule at this route. That is not the same as saying they are false — it marks where the evidence is missing.
Quick-start dose/route: 100 mcg CJC + 100 mcg Ipamorelin per injection, SubQ, 1-2x daily. GAP — UNSUPPORTED EXACT BLEND. Exact-blend searches found narrative reviews but no abstract administering this fixed formulation. Standalone Ipamorelin PMID 10496658 and swine PMID 9849822 do not verify the blend; PMID 16352683 is long-acting CJC-1295, not no-DAC Mod GRF(1-29).
Mechanism: simultaneous GHRH-receptor and GHS-R1a activation producing 3-5x synergistic GH pulses. GAP — UNSUPPORTED EXACT BLEND. No checked abstract measured this mechanism or the claimed amplification for the pre-mixed product.
Primary safety: favorable cortisol/prolactin profile and long-term blend tolerability. GAP — UNSUPPORTED EXACT BLEND. No abstract established human safety for this exact blend, route, dose, and repeated schedule.

Side effects & safety
Commonly reported
- Transient flushing or warmth post-injection (resolves in minutes)
- Mild tingling or head rush immediately after injection
- Improved sleep quality and vivid dreams (desired effect)
- Mild water retention in first 1-2 weeks (subsides)
Less common & notes
- Rarely reported: headache, mild lethargy, temporary joint stiffness from water retention.
- Ipamorelin does NOT meaningfully elevate cortisol, prolactin, or aldosterone at standard doses - this is its key advantage over other GHRPs.
- Very high doses (above 300mcg Ipamorelin) provide no additional GH benefit and may increase side effects.
- Both components have favorable safety profiles in human studies, but long-term data for the combination beyond 6 months is limited.

Regulatory status
Not FDA-approved as a combination product. Available through compounding pharmacies with prescription. CJC-1295 no DAC (Mod GRF 1-29) has published human pharmacokinetic data. Ipamorelin has Phase 2 clinical trial data for post-operative ileus. Pre-mixed blends are a compounding pharmacy product. Classified as research peptides in most jurisdictions. All use is experimental and off-label.
